2 Commits
main ... 0.1.4

Author SHA1 Message Date
daa019f0c3 feat: Updates to build arm images in ci
Some checks failed
Create and publish a Docker image / build-and-push-image (push) Failing after 6s
2024-11-05 12:35:29 -05:00
d45957fbc3 feat: Updates to build arm images in ci
Some checks failed
Create and publish a Docker image / build-and-push-image (push) Failing after 6s
2024-11-05 12:26:43 -05:00

View File

@@ -35,6 +35,10 @@ jobs:
registry: ${{ env.REGISTRY }}
username: ${{ github.actor }}
password: ${{ secrets.GITHUB_TOKEN }}
- name: Set up QEMU
uses: docker/setup-qemu-action@v2
- name: Set up Docker Buildx
uses: docker-setup-buildx-action@v2
# This step uses [docker/metadata-action](https://github.com/docker/metadata-action#about) to extract tags and labels that will be applied to the specified image. The `id` "meta" allows the output of this step to be referenced in a subsequent step. The `images` value provides the base name for the tags and labels.
- name: Extract metadata (tags, labels) for Docker
id: meta
@@ -56,6 +60,7 @@ jobs:
push: true
tags: ${{ steps.meta.outputs.tags }}
labels: ${{ steps.meta.outputs.labels }}
platforms: linux/amd64,linux/arm64
# This step generates an artifact attestation for the image, which is an unforgeable statement about where and how it was built. It increases supply chain security for people who consume the image. For more information, see "[AUTOTITLE](/actions/security-guides/using-artifact-attestations-to-establish-provenance-for-builds)."
- name: Generate artifact attestation